Device Properties - Connector Pin Terminals
To display/modify the active connector pin terminal of a device:
-
select the desired device in the working area and click on the command Format -> Device Properties.... Switch to the tab Connector Pin Terminals or
-
right-click on the symbol assigned to a device and select the command Device Properties from the displayed context menu. Switch to the tab Connector Pin Terminals or
-
right-click on a pin or pin text of the symbol and select the command Pin Properties from the displayed context menu. Switch to the tab Connector Pin Terminals or
-
right-click in the device tree of the Project window on the desired device and select the command Pin Properties from the displayed context menu. Switch to the tab Connector Pin Terminals.
The following dialog box is displayed:

Pin |
Displays the pin names of the selected device. |
|
Boolean Expression |
Displays, if existing, the defined Boolean expression (harness derivative, option) on the wire.
NoteOptions are displayed in square brackets. Example: [Option 1]. |
|
Disable automatic selection |
If this option is activated, the connector pin terminal is not determined depending on the setting Use physical data of
All other checks under Conductor Assignment Procedure are then valid for the connector pin terminal. |
|
Displays the current connector pin terminal for each wire in the selected connection path.
Clicking on the cell opens a selection list from which a connector pin terminal can be selected.
Once this is done, the option Disable automatic selection is activated automatically
